About the Venue

Purple Park Inclusive Playground is an all-inclusive play area at the front of the Daphne Sports Complex. The city specifically identifies it as an inclusive playground and places it beside family-friendly amenities including restrooms, trails, parking, and the Jubilee Splash Pad nearby. For most families, it works best as a free outdoor stop that can be paired with other complex amenities rather than as a fully separate destination park.
